As an Information Security Analyst, you will work closely with the Information Security Manager and Chief Information Security Officer to maintain and improve Ping Identity ’s Information Security Management System. You will develop and maintain security policies, assess and review policy compliance across the organisation, assess organisational security risks and develop risk treatment strategies, support internal and external audit activities, and provide customer assurance by engaging in customer assessments and audits, working with internal teams and control owners to understand, document and implement customer contractual security requirements.
